Going against what seemed like an obvious assumption, it's actually the case that Highguard did not need to pay for its high-profile finale spot at The Game Awards. This revelation has caught the attention of both fans and industry insiders, as the prestigious event is often associated with significant financial investments for promotional opportunities.
The Game Awards, known for celebrating excellence in gaming, has traditionally featured a mix of award presentations and exclusive game reveals. Highguard's inclusion in the finale has led many to speculate about the financial dynamics at play. However, sources indicate that the decision to feature Highguard was based on its merit and the excitement generated by its upcoming release, rather than a monetary transaction.
This news challenges the perception that high-profile slots at major gaming events are solely reserved for those who can afford to pay. It opens up discussions about the criteria used by event organizers when selecting games for such coveted positions. As the gaming community awaits the launch of Highguard, this insight adds an intriguing layer to the ongoing conversation about marketing and visibility in the industry.
